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:132672 Wilson MD, et al., ARS2 is a conserved eukaryotic gene essential for early mammalian development. Mol Cell Biol. 2008 Mar;28(5):1503-14
Assay type: Northern blot
MGI Accession ID: MGI:3785711
Gene symbol: Srrt
Gene name: serrate RNA effector molecule homolog (Arabidopsis)
Probe: ARS2 3' probe
Probe preparation: Double stranded labelled with P32 DNA
Visualized with: Phosphorimaging
